THINGS TO KEEP IN MIND

  • Before sublimating the yellow, blue, and orange backpacks, please note that the colours of the backpack will mix with those of the image you wish to print. It is recommended to use a dark design to minimise this effect
  • It is recommended to leave the cords and the animal-shaped bag outside of the press to prevent them from being burned or damaged during the dye sublimation printing
  • To personalise with DTF, follow the time, temperature, and pressure parameters recommended by the film manufacturer. Also, ensure not to exceed the maximum temperature the fabric can withstand

RECOMMENDED INSTRUCTIONS AND PARAMETERS FOR SUBLIMATION PRINTING

Parameters given for guidance only. It is recommended to carry out preliminary tests in order to make the necessary adjustments before starting production.

  • Print the design in mirror mode
  • Preheat the press to 200 ºC
  • Insert protective paper inside the backpack so that the ink does not transfer to the other side
  • Place the backpack on the base of the press and the printed part of the paper on the backpack. Fix it with thermal adhesive tape
  • Place protective paper
  • Close the press with medium-high pressure for 25-30 seconds
  • With the help of a protective glove, remove the freshly sublimated backpack
  • Carefully peel off the paper
